Your Business Needs A Strong Brand

Picture Source

If your business is struggling to make an impact on its target market then you might want to look at the brand you’re presenting. It isn’t goods or services that sell a company in the modern age – it’s your image. Unless you’ve invented a revolutionary new product that’s unlike anything else in any other industry, you’re probably not selling anything different. Your competitors all offer high-quality goods and services that are similar or identical to yours. It isn’t enough to simply deliver an effective service because your competitors are doing the same. What makes their company different to yours? The brand.

When a consumer is deciding which business to choose for a certain service, they make their decision based on the brand. And if your business doesn’t have a good level of brand awareness amongst its target market then you’re wasting your potential to increase your profits and become a more reputable name within your industry. You’re in competition, whether you like it or not, and your business can quickly become irrelevant if you’re not continuously thinking of new ways to stand out. Here are some ways in which you could improve your brand.

Value your customers.

If you want to boost your brand then you need to demonstrate to your customers that you care. The best way to do that is to make a statement and prove that you value them. Promoting human values in your branding is a good way to start. Consumers are people and they connect with a message that represents something which truly matters to them. Forget corporate ideals; none of that jargon will impress customers. You need a statement that really matters in the world. You could deliver an environmentally-conscious service so as to prove that your business cares about more than making a profit. You could even donate money to certain charities so as to make a real impact on people’s lives.

The key is to value your customers as people, rather than statistics. You have to make a point of proving that you’re not just hungry for the consumer’s money. You could start a loyalty scheme, for example, so that long-term customers get deals and discounts for their continued custom. It’s all about making small gestures to build loyalty between the customer and the business. You might even want to give them access to your business’ interactive annual reports so as to give readers the opportunity to see your company’s financial records from their own mobile devices or computers if they want to. The more open your business is with its customers, the more they’ll feel they can trust your brand. And that’s the most crucial thing, after all. Your customers will only know that you value them once they feel that you’re open and honest with them.

Improve your marketing approach.

Of course, the final ingredient for a successful brand is a strong marketing approach. You’ve most likely marketed your business in some form before, but that doesn’t mean you’ve done an effective job. You might not be reaching the full potential of your target market. If you’re using traditional advertising methods such as billboards or business cards then you’re just not going to reach all the consumers that you could be reaching. You need to consider digital marketing if you’ve not already got an online plan of action.

Start off by improving your business’ website because this is an important tool when it comes to reaching potential customers through the internet. You don’t actually need to spend a thing to successfully market your brand. Focus on your site’s content. If you use relevant keywords and a professional design that’s responsive to all manner of devices then your website will impress the algorithms used by search engines such as Google. When that happens, you’ll show up at the top of the page in search results, and that means potential customers are more likely to see your website before they see your competitors’ websites. Think of it in the same way as a billboard or a poster but it’s free and far more people will see it.

Improve your social media game.

On the topic of online content, social media is one of the most powerful resources you have at your disposal if you want to create a strong brand. You need to post captivating content on a regular basis in order to build up your number of followers and keep them interested. A good rule of thumb is to post about things other than your brand. People don’t want to hear you harp on about how great your company is; post content that’s interesting because it’s more likely to get shared and drive an audience towards your business’ social media profiles. That’s how you expand your brand.
